EPA National Pesticide Information Center (NPIC). Due 8/7.

Opportunity Title:

National Pesticide Information Center (NPIC)



Opportunity Number:

EPA-OCSPP-OPP-2023-002



Description:

The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) Pesticide Re-evaluation Division in the Office of Pesticide Programs (OPP) is soliciting applications from eligible organizations to establish a National Pesticide Information Center (NPIC), a program that provides the public with objective, science-based information on pesticide-related subjects through a website, toll-free telephone service, and outreach. Trained experts will respond to questions on the risks associated with pesticide use, restrictions on pesticide use, who to contact for regulatory enforcement, how to report information on a suspected pesticide exposure and more. Secondarily, NPIC program staff will collect information on suspected incidents that callers give voluntarily.



Eligibility:

States, U.S. territories and possessions, federally recognized Indian tribal governments and Native American organizations, public and private universities and colleges, other public or private nonprofit institutions, and local governments.



Total Amount Available:

$10,000,000



Maximum Award:

$10,000,000



Application Deadline:

August 7, 2023
